Improved ability to press and play through pressing lines. Improved ability to play the first pass forward into a channel when winning possession.
The game starts with two teams working together in possession, and one team pressing to regain the ball. The possession teams keep the ball while the defending team attempt to win it. The possession teams are on limited (e.g. 2 touch) but can also use the goalkeepers as well. If the ball is lost, the defending team try to score in any of the goals as quickly as possible, while the possession teams counter press. If the defending team score, the team that lost the ball become the defending team. Progression 1: The team that lost the ball become the counter pressing team, while the other possession team help the defending team score. Progression 2: The possession teams can score a “goal” by completing a set number of passes.
